Company Name

Industry

Location

Revenue

Employees

Bad Dog Games

Gambling & Casinos

United States, Texas

$250M to $500M

1-10

Casino Creations

Gambling & Casinos

United States, Texas

$1M to $5M

1-10

Aaron Group I

Gambling & Casinos

United States, Texas

Under $1M

1-10

Stadium Technologies

Gambling & Casinos

United States, Texas

Under $1M

1-10